What should I see when I'm in Rectortown?
If you want to find some ways to explore Rectortown while making the most of your travel budget, this destination has a lot to offer. Spots where you’ll find the natural beauty on display include Shenandoah National Park, Sky Meadows State Park, and Shenandoah River. Other places not to be missed include Robert Trent Jones Golf Course, Catoctin Valley, and State Arboretum of Virginia.
